Job description
- Align with a specific portfolio of infrastructure technologies such as Database, Identity Management, Middleware, Messaging, and AI Infrastructure platforms.
- Develop a deep understanding of vulnerability findings and lifecycle risks within the assigned portfolio.
- Drive the prioritization of remediation activities based on risk and impact.
- Collaborate with engineering teams, vendors, and subject matter experts to implement solutions.
- Ensure the timely remediation of security vulnerabilities.
- Manage the elimination of end-of-support (EOS) and end-of-life (EOL) technologies.
- Oversee planning for upgrades, migrations, and decommissioning of infrastructure components.
Requirements
We are seeking a skilled and motivated Technology Product Owner to support the Core Technology Infrastructure organization. In this role, you will ensure the timely remediation of security vulnerabilities and the elimination of end-of-support technologies across critical infrastructure domains. You will develop deep familiarity with vulnerability findings and lifecycle risks, drive the prioritization of remediation activities, and collaborate with engineering teams and subject matter experts to implement effective solutions., Infrastructure Domain Knowledge: Experience with one or more of the following is required:
- Databases: Oracle, SQL Server, PostgreSQL
- Identity Access Management: IAM, Active Directory, Azure AD
- Middleware Platforms: WebSphere, WebLogic, Tomcat
- Messaging Systems: Kafka, MQ, RabbitMQ
- AI / Compute Infrastructure Platforms
Vulnerability Management:
- Understanding of CVEs, risk scores, and remediation prioritization.
- Experience with vulnerability scanning tools such as Qualys or Tenable.
Technical Skills:
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and Microsoft Outlook.
- Automation or scripting experience with Python or PowerShell.
Experience:
- Experience in large enterprise environments is required.
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form.
- Relevant certifications (e.g., CISM, CISSP, SAFe PO/PM, ITIL).
